Webbsklearn.metrics.mean_absolute_percentage_error (y_true, y_pred, sample_weight=None, multioutput='uniform_average') [ソース] 平均絶対パーセント誤差回帰損失。 ここで、出力を [0, 100] の範囲のパーセンテージで表していないことに注意してください。 代わりに、範囲 [0, 1/eps] で表します。 詳細については、 ユーザー ガイド を参照してください。 … Webb7 juli 2024 · MAE (Mean Absolute Error) is the average absolute error between actual and predicted values. Absolute error, also known as L1 loss, is a row level error calculation where the non-negative difference between the prediction and the actual is calculated.
